Formal concept analysis based web pages classification/visualization and their application to information retrieval

The net users are required a lot of time to treat with web search engines due to their retrieved results as ranking lists. In order to reduce load of users, ‘search@once’ that provides well-structured outputs as line-diagram, is proposed. The proposed system employs formal concept analysis to classify web pages and visualize the lattice structure of web pages and keywords as line diagram. This system is implemented on the computer (CPU=2.83GHz!$MM=2GB), by using Python, which is an object-oriented programming language, Application Program Interface (API), and one of the GUI libraries, Tkinter. Through the subjective evaluation and sign test with seven subjects, it is confirmed that search@once is helpful to understand the overview of the retrieved results and to find new keywords for refining the results.
